Trevor Day managed through a push by Nightingale-Bamford in the fifth inning where Trevor Day coughed up four runs, but Trevor Day still won 8-6 on Friday.
There was plenty of action on the basepaths as Trevor Day collected 11 hits and Nightingale-Bamford had eight. Trevor Day got things moving in the first inning, when Callie Landberg doubled on a 0-2 count, scoring two runs. Trevor Day tallied three runs in the sixth inning. Trevor Day big bats were led by Clementine Yockey and Gabby Perello, who all drove in runs. Trevor Day tallied 11 hits on the day. Jojo Greenberg, Yockey, and Luz Rivera each had multiple hits for Trevor Day. Yockey and Greenberg all had three hits to lead Trevor Day.
Riley Gleason earned the win for Trevor Day. She surrendered six runs on eight hits over seven innings, striking out seven.
